Your Pocket PC Phone is designed by default to turn itself off if not used
for 3 minutes. This period can be adjusted to a maximum of 5 minutes.
Refer to the Power setting in Chapter 5 for more information.

1
Check the Brightness setting by tapping the Start menu > Set-
tings > the System tab > the Backlight > Brightness tab.
2
Prolonged exposure to direct sunlight may also cause your Pocket
PC Phonescreen to temporarily darken. This is normal for LCD
screens and is not permanent.
